Hottest ticket around: Comic Anjelah Johnson and her ‘Bon Qui Qui’ character
Trying to get tickets to see comedian Anjelah Johnson perform at Tachi Palace?
Good luck.
Thursday’s showing to watch the woman also known as “Bon Qui Qui” is sold out.
Even the secondary ticket market, such as Stubhub.com, did not have any tickets as of Tuesday evening for the showing in Lemoore.
Tickets have been on sale since June 16, starting at $35.

Johnson, who has had her stand-up comedy routine “Not Fancy” aired on Netflix, is perhaps best known for her alter ego “Bon Qui Qui,” a rude fast food employee with no filter and little patience.
The “Bon Qui Qui” skit, which originally aired on Mad TV, has been viewed more than 73 million times on YouTube.
Johnson also is responsible for the viral “Nail salon” cartoon skit, which features a female who ends up getting scolded for not having a boyfriend and gets upsold services while getting her nails done.
“That’s why you have no boyfren,” the manicurists tells the female cartoon character in the “Nail salon” skit.
The “Nail salon” skit has been viewed more than 12 million times.
Johnson has been on tour since July 4. Her Thursday showing at Tachi Palace will be her 15th stop of 17 performances.
